About Chris:

I am a private tutor with a fully licensed teaching credential and Master's Degree in Education looking to teach students of all ages and abilities. I have a deep love for kids and a passion for teaching. I have extensive scholastic experience - successfully teaching by myself an entire year's worth of curriculum in both the high school and junior high settings.

I specialize in tutoring K-12 students with homework help in both English and Spanish language, literature, and composition. As a published writer, I offer help in all academic and professional writing endeavors, including essays, school projects, and works of creativity. In addition to homework help, I offer private Spanish language lessons, SAT preparation, studies in college-level literature, mathematics, and piano / guitar lessons.
